GamePro Issue 261

ISSUE: 261Content

Inside (Contents)

From the Editor

Inbox (Letters)

Games Need Diversity – Why including more women & races are good for gaming.

Plastic Axe – The myth that music games don’t breed an interest in learning musical instruments.

Bitmob – The perils of publishers recouping sales from used games with downloadable content.

Spawn Point: A Boy Enters Limbo (Xbox 360), Interview with Halo: Reach Creative Director Marcus Lehto & Executive Producer Joseph Tung, Coming Soon to Theaters (Uncharted, Lost Planet, Mass Effect, Everquest), Married with Sims (The Sims 3 for Xbox 360), A Jam Session (NBA Jam for Wii, PS3 & Xbox 360), Deus Ex 3 (PS3, Xbox 360, PC, released as Deus Ex: Human Revolution), The Story of GameStop, Hunted: The Demon Forge (PS3, Xbox 360, PC), Interview with God of War III Director Stig Asmussen, May 2010 calendar.

Cover Story: Star Wars: The Force Unleashed 2 (PS3, Xbox 360, Wii, PC, DS)

Reviews:

·         Tom Clancy's Splinter Cell: Conviction (Xbox 360, PC)

·         Pokemon HeartGold/SoulSilver (DS)

·         Red Steel 2 (Wii)

·         Super Street Fighter IV (PS3, Xbox 360)

·         3D Dot Game Heroes (PS3)

Bonus Level: Geek Gear
